Village Overview

Limla is a village in Purna Taluka,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Parbhani district, Maharashtra. For Limla, the population is 1,594, PIN code is 431402 and Census village code is 547244. Location and Administration

Limla comes under Limla gram panchayat and Purna C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Purna Taluka,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The taluka headquarters is Purna at 20 km. The Census district headquarters, Parbhani, is 28 km away.
